Actress Billie Piper, while promoting Netflix’s film “Scoop,” revealed that her co-star Gillian Anderson has a love for sugary snacks, particularly full-fat Coke, which she drinks on set. The film details the royal scandal surrounding Prince Andrew, with Billie playing the role of Newsnight producer Sam McAlister, and Gillian playing Emily Maitlis. Rufus Sewell portrays Prince Andrew and had to undergo hours of prosthetic makeup to convincingly portray the character. Gillian shared a behind-the-scenes photo on Instagram with Rufus in makeup.

Critics had mixed opinions about the film, with some feeling that it missed the real story of the scandal, while others praised the high-level performances of the cast. The film aims to reflect the tensions behind booking the Duke of York for Newsnight and the aftermath of his association with Jeffrey Epstein. Following the broadcast in 2019 and the public backlash, Prince Andrew stepped down from his royal duties.
